Where is This Key Valve Located?


The primary water line supply can vary, so you might require to locate time to determine where it is. Unfortunately, when your home is obtaining soaked as a result of a burst pipeline, you don't have the deluxe of time throughout an emergency. Thus, you need to prepare for this plumbing predicament by learning where the valve is located.
This shutoff valve could look like a sphere valve (with a lever-type deal with) or an entrance valve (with a circle spigot). Positioning relies on the age of your house and the environment in your location. Inspect the complying with usual areas:
  • Interior of Home: In chillier environments, the city supply pipelines encounter your house. Check usual energy areas like your cellar, laundry room, or garage. A most likely place is near the hot water heater. In the cellar, this valve will certainly go to your eye degree. On the various other major floors, you might need to bend down to discover it.

  • Outdoors on the Exterior Wall surface: The primary shutoff is outside the home in exotic climates where they do not experience winter months. It is often linked to an outside wall surface. Check for it near an exterior tap.

  • Outdoors by the Street: If you can't find the valve anywhere else, it is time to inspect your road. It could be outside next to your water meter. It could be below the access panel near the ground on your street. You may need a meter key that's marketed in equipment shops to remove the panel cover. You can locate 2 shutoffs, one for city usage as well as one for your residence. See to it you turned off the right one. And also you will certainly know that you did when none of the faucets in your house release freshwater.


  • What to Do When a Pipe Bursts in Your Home


    A burst pipe is one of a homeowner's worst nightmares. Not knowing the signs and being unprepared for this plumbing issue can result in more water damage and clean up. Here are the warning signs of a pipe about to burst and the steps you can take if it happens.


    Warning Signs for Burst Pipes


  • Rusty, discolored water with a bad smell


  • Puddles under your sinks


  • Abrupt changes in water pressure


  • A spike in your water bill


  • Clanging noises coming from pipes behind the walls


  • What to Do When a Pipe Bursts


    Turn off your water. The sooner you do this, the better. Shutting off your main valve will help minimize the damage to your home.



    Drain the faucets. After the water has been turned off, drain the remaining water by opening your faucets. Doing so will help prevent areas from freezing and also relieve pressure within your pipe system to avoid more bursts.



    Locate the burst pipe. Look for bulging ceilings, warping and other signs of where the water damage has occurred. Once you locate the pipe, you will be able to determine if it is a small crack that can be patched or a major repair that needs to be dealt with right away.

    Document the damage. If you have extensive pipe damage, be sure to take photos of the affected areas so you can document a claim with your insurance. Take close-up photos of the damage and use a measuring tape to show how high the water is. You should also take photos from different angles for a wider picture of the affected areas.



    Start cleaning. After you have documented the damage, start cleaning up the water as soon as possible. The longer the water sits, the higher the chance that mold will develop.
